Primary and Secondary research

Primary research is a first hand research which is conducted by yourself alone without the help of any other resources. Some of the examples are questionnaire, observations and interviews. There has been a lot of primary research within our coursework.  List of topics that are based on primary research: cast notes, documentary analysis, questionnaire.

Secondary research is a second hand research where you get all the information from somewhere else. Some of the examples are the handouts given at lesson, library books, text books and internet. List of the topics that are based on secondary research: genre research, rule of third and audience research.
